Quick note: the Pinewheel transcode farm choked on the overnight batch again. Looks like the GPU workers on the Driftvale pool ran out of scratch disk mid-job, so segments queued up and timed out. Purge the scratch volumes and requeue the failed segments before alerting anyone. The stuck batch's trace token follows.

pipeline stamp: htk3_a71

## Memo: Brindle Licensing Dispute — Finance Team

Quick update on the Brindlecore licensing mess. Their counsel claims our Fenwick module exceeds the seat count in the 2021 agreement; our logs say otherwise. We're holding the disputed payment in escrow for now, so flag it separately in month-end reporting. Settlement talks start next week in Ardenvale. Our negotiating position is outlined below.

management briefing: The renewal with Zoraelax Group closes at $10 million a year, 15 percent below the last contract. Project Ralael slips by six weeks because of the audit delay.

## Service Accounts — StormFan Alert Fan-Out

The fan-out worker authenticates to the internal dispatch tier using the svc-stormfan account. Rotate quarterly; scopes are limited to publish-only on alert topics. If deliveries stall during your shift, verify the worker is using the current credential, reproduced below for reference.

API key for kaweg-hahif: kto4_rAjZ